If the question is on acrylics, they generally melt between 300-320 degrees F and start boiling at around 400 ° F.

There are a wide variety of different kinds of paint so there is no single answer to this question; a good rule of thumb would be to use the solvent's flash point.

Is the boiling point a negative number for neon?

Whether or not the boiling point of neon is negative depends on the temperature scale used to describe the boiling point. If the boiling point is given in Celsius or Fahrenheit, the boiling point is negative. However, in Kelvin, which cannot be negative, the boiling point is positive.
